What Drives Industrial Building Value in Hamilton
Hamilton is served by the QEW, Highway 403, Lincoln Alexander Parkway and Red Hill Valley Parkway, with commercial activity concentrated around the Downtown Core, Stoney Creek, Ancaster Business Park and Red Hill Business Park. Growth is being driven by port expansion and downtown revitalization, and Industrial & Multi-Residential remains the dominant commercial asset class locally. For industrial buildings specifically, industrial cap rates in most Southern Ontario markets remain among the tightest of any asset class due to persistent tenant demand, though smaller, older or functionally obsolete buildings can offer meaningfully higher yields.
